All scheduled batch jobs were drained beforehand, re-queued afterward, and verified against checksums. Customers on the legacy endpoint will see a deprecation notice for two weeks. If tickets mention slow resizes or dimension mismatches, confirm the customer's CLI version before escalating, since old builds ignore the new defaults. For reference when troubleshooting, the cluster now runs with the following configuration.

settings of fafog-haduf:
ZORIX_PIN=4648
ZORIX_METRICS_HOST=metrics.zorix.paliqsys.corp
ZORIX_LOG_LEVEL=info
ZORIX_TENANT=druix

# Tracehawk Environments

Quick tour: we run three environments — sandbox, staging, and prod. Traces flow through the Tracehawk collector in each; sandbox samples everything, prod samples 5%. If spans look orphaned, it's almost always a propagation header getting stripped by the edge proxy. Staging mirrors prod config except for retention. Each collector boots with the values listed here:

settings of bafof-fajog:
[aldix]
port = 9300
region = north-3
host = aldix.kelvilabs.example
team = istath
timeout_ms = 1500
retries = 8

## Runbook 4.2 — Account Recovery: Export Timezone Handling

When restoring a locked Tidemark Reports account, verify the user's export timezone before re-enabling scheduled jobs. Exports are rendered in the account's stored zone, not UTC; a mismatch after recovery will shift all timestamps in downstream reports. Confirm the zone against the audit log, re-run one sample export, and compare. To unlock the recovery console itself, enter the passphrase below. It is:

unlock words, hahip-baduf: holwyn-istath-julvan

# Deployment

Tidemark Widget ships as a single static bundle plus a small API shim. Build with `make bundle`, push to the Seabright CDN bucket, then restart the shim. No blue-green; downtime is seconds. The shim serves cached tide tables for Port Anselm and Gullwick harbors, so stale data after deploy is expected for up to five minutes. Do not edit config on the box — changes go through the repo. The shim reads the following configuration at startup.

config for bawig-fadup:
[zorix]
host = zorix.lumicworks.corp
user = zorix_svc
database = zorix_prod